I keep getting this error the msnp32.dll file error message. So I un-installed the "Client for Microsoft Networks." Then I re-installed it. Now that message is solved. Before I couldn't see anyone on the network and now I can. But now I get this error message when I open internet explorer,"Cannot open Internet site https://<Web address>. A connection to the server could not be established." I don't know why this is coming up. If you guys could help me out that'll be great. I'm using windows 98. If you could help me step-by-step. note that the error message says https and not http. https refers to encrypted http pages.
I suspect that http pages work but not https pages.Just guessing,could be wrong.

Have you got a https web site as your home page ?

Try changing your home page to something else.

You could also try deleting your Temporary Internet Files folder, and your Cookies.
